True, but this is because all third parties are small and can't grow because they can't campaign. They can't campaign because they don't get corporate donations an aren't puppet candidates. My party SPUSA, has about 15,000 people but most people don't even know it exsists.

The thing about politics in America Nowadays is that for the majority of people it isn't a candidates qualifications or platform but his looks his height his speeches and how flashy his campaign is.

Public funding of elections would open up the field for more parties. It would also let the politicians spend more time GOVERNING instead of fundraising. One other benefit would be a substantial reduction in the vast power the lobbyists hold over the politicians.
